Taman Golden Dragon, Kampar, Perak

Taman Golden Dragon in Kampar, Perak recorded 18 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, with a median price of RM641K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M233.

This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M641K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M608K to RM673K, and a typical market range of RM551K to RM730K.

Most transactions involved 2 - 2 1/2 storey semi-detached, with moderate diversity in property types available.

For price per square foot, the median is RM233, with most transactions between RM216 and RM250. The usual range is RM217.53 to RM248.03, showing that most units are priced quite close to each other. A typical spread (IQR) of RM30.50 and an average deviation (MAD) of RM17 indicate a highly stable PSF trend across properties.
